Mary Anne Noble

June 28, 1928 — July 1, 2018

Mary Noble, of Groton, Massachusetts, formerly of Pines Lake, Wayne, New Jersey, passed away at home on Sunday, July 1, surrounded by her loving family. Mary recently turned 90 years of age, a goal she very much wanted to reach. She was born on June 28, 1928, in Newark, New Jersey, to Patrick and Everett Toal and attended St. Vincent Academy.

In early 1950 Mary met and fell in love with Gerry Noble at a dance at the Ivanhoe. They were married on September 9, 1950, and went on to have 4 children and 9 grandchildren, her greatest source of pride and accomplishment.

Some of Mary's happiest times were summer vacations at the Jersey Shore with Gerry and all the kids and grandkids. She always said her most enjoyable moments of those vacations were listening to her family talking, laughing and just spending time together.

Mary's calling and profession was nursing, receiving her RN from St. Joseph Hospital School of Nursing in Paterson, New Jersey, in 1949. She started her nursing career at St. Joseph's Hospital and later became Supervisor of the Intensive Care Unit at Chilton Memorial Hospital in Pompton Plains, retiring after 26 years in 1991. But her best nursing was practiced right in her Osceola Road neighborhood in Pines Lake, her neighbors often calling her for expert advice and eventually naming her the NMD (Neighborhood Medical Diagnostician)

She was an active member of the Pines Lake Women's and Garden Clubs and then joined the Women's Club in Groton, Massachusetts, when she and Gerry moved there in 2005 to her daughter Mary Ellen and husband Paul's home. Mary also loved swimming with the Groton Seniors at the Groton School.

Mary was an avid reader of mystery books, loved watching detective shows with her grandchildren, playing Scrabble, and then Yahtzee in her later years and could never resist a Talbot's sale!

She is survived by sons Stephen and wife Anne of Poland, Maine; Patrick and wife Lenore of New London, New Hampshire; daughters Mary Ellen and husband Paul Cappucci of Groton, Massachusetts; and Susan and husband Paul Munson of Cohasset, Massachusetts; 8 grandchildren - Matthew, Timothy, Cristina, Michael, Stefanie, Molly, Zachary, and Melissa, as well as several nieces, nephews and many longtime friends. She was predeceased by her husband Gerald, grandson Nicholas and her siblings, Anna Stobach, Patrick Toal, and James Toal.
